WebMar 24, 2024 · In case the time limit has expired, you can make an application to the sub-registrar for condonation of the delay, within the next four months and the registrar may agree to register such documents, on payment of a fine that may be up to ten times the original registration fee. WebDec 26, 2024 · In Indian Property law As per Section 6 of the Transfer of Property Act, the property of any sort might be moved. The individual demanding non-transferability must demonstrate the presence of some law or custom which limits the privilege of the move.
